City Guide
Samaniego, Araba, Spain
Overview
Samaniego is a charming, small village set in the famed Rioja Alavesa wine region of northern Spain. Surrounded by rolling vineyards and historic wineries, the town is prized for its tranquil atmosphere and Basque heritage. Samaniego is perfect for wine lovers and those seeking an authentic rural Spanish experience.
Best Time to Visit
September-October for grape harvest and wine festivals, or May-June for pleasant weather and blooming vineyards.
Local Tips
Dine early if possible, as local restaurants may have limited evening hours. Book wine tours in advance, and consider renting a car for the most flexibility in exploring the region.
Cultural Etiquette
Casual dress is suitable, but dress modestly in churches. Tipping is appreciated but not obligatory (rounding up or leaving small change is common). Greeting people with a polite 'Buenos días' goes a long way.
Safety Warnings
Samaniego is very safe with little crime, but be cautious on rural roads, especially after dark, as lighting and signage may be limited.
Hidden Gems
Climb the San León hill for panoramic views or seek out the small, family-run wineries rarely visited by tourists. Enjoy a peaceful walk along the old Camino Real trail.
